With the use of good tuning of the VVT system, FI can be applied even with 11:1 satic ratio and modest boost. This is what the guys are finding right now over in the states.

Will need more time to really see how durable they will be though, but, food for thought, with IVC at 0 degrees you have 11:1, with IVC at 50 degrees you have ~9.5:1 (pretty much where FPV's static CR is with F/I).

Now this is only looking at one aspect of the tune, it's very simplistic and is not accounting for the consequences of also having the intake valve OPEN later (since duration is fixed)... but it's something to think about and probably something that can help with achieving higher static CR in conjuction with FI.
